Jonah Hill in talks to join Matt Reeves' The Batman in a mystery role


Jeffrey Wright is being eyed for the role of Commissioner Gordon in the upcoming DC Comics adaptation, with Jonah Hill being eyed to play a villain, though his exact role remains a mystery at this time.

Robert Pattinson is set to star as the Dark Knight. Matt Reeves took over the directing gig after Ben Affleck stepped away from the role. Affleck was also expected to play Batman again but then said he would be hanging up the cape for good. Reeves has since described the film as a "defining" and "very personal" story about the Dark Knight, rather than an origin story in the vein of Frank Miller's beloved "Year One" series.

According to sources, producers had long wanted Hill for the project, but casting decisions were put on hold until the role of Batman was filled. The deal hasn't closed and sources say it could still fall apart, but both sides are engaging on Hill joining. As for who Hill is playing, that's still being worked out as well, but sources say he's being eyed for a villain role.

Hill made his feature directorial debut with last year's A24 movie Mid90s. He was Oscar-nominated for supporting acting roles in Moneyball (2011) and Wolf of Wall Street, The (2013).
